Transaction 6870f7091a8a2ffcd93046cd9232647b8b0e61d1223bacb40493bbab6a2a8591
1 Input
1 Outputs
- 6870f7091a8a2ffcd93046cd9232647b8b0e61d1223bacb40493bbab6a2a8591:0
value 12353605
address 1JRhUL93J6B8LyM2tPtiUbTKb21MiWGhty